Educators teach deep learning with MATLAB by drawing on available course modules, onramp tutorials, and code examples. With domain-specific toolboxes and apps, MATLAB makes it easy for students to learn and perform domain-specific deep learning tasks involving data preprocessing, image labeling, network design and transfer learning.
MATLAB supports interoperability with open source deep learning frameworks, enabling students to apply TensorFlow, PyTorch, and other popular frameworks in their MATLAB deep learning projects.
Below is a sampling of course curricula, textbooks, code examples, and additional tools for teaching deep learning with MATLAB.
Course Curricula
Introduction to AI
Image, Audio and Signal processing:
Biomedicine
Reinforcement Learning
- Northeastern University: teaching modules, introduction webinar (22:50)
Textbooks
Deep learning
Machine learning
MATLAB Resources
- MATLAB Onramp (2-hour introductory tutorial)
- Deep Learning Onramp (2-hour introductory tutorial)
- Deep Learning with MATLAB (16-hour in-depth course)
- Deep Learning Toolbox (Documentation)
- Gallery of deep learning applications (Code examples)
- MATLAB Online (use MATLAB in your browser)
- MATLAB Grader (automatically grade MATLAB coding assignments)
- Latest features and resources for Data Science, Deep Learning & Machine Learning (recent release product features)
- Deep Learning (Blog)